Grounded Hearts


If you're looking for a good -- actually really good -- reading choice for your summer reading, please put Grounded Hearts  at the top of your list. I especially enjoy historical fiction and have read many books set during World War II, but the setting -- Ireland -- and the characters and plot make it an absorbing book.

Nan O'Neil is a widowed midwife in neutral Ireland who gives shelter to a wounded Canadian RAF pilot. Taking in Dutch Whitney is against the law and Nan faces prison for this act. I will avoid any plot spoilers, but the story drew me and kept me reading. I especially enjoyed the scenes of life in Ireland during the war and the characters who are part of Nan's life. It's a romance, and an unusually sweet one, a historical novel and a story of faith. I am hoping that there will be a sequel. Please, Jeanne M.
